Job Title: Supervising Clinic Nurse I

Job Summary:

The County of Los Angeles is seeking a highly skilled and experienced Supervising Clinic Nurse I to join our team. As a Supervising Clinic Nurse I, you will be responsible for providing leadership and guidance to a team of nursing personnel in a clinic or emergency care unit. You will be responsible for planning, directing, and coordinating nursing activities to ensure the delivery of high-quality patient care.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Plan and direct nursing activities in a unit, coordinating with medical and other health services staff to provide prompt and quality patient care.
  • Interpret nursing philosophy, goals, policies, and procedures to employees, patients, or others.
  • Prepare work schedules and daily assignments for nursing staff members, matching skills to duties to be performed.
  • Review and evaluate employee performance, writing anecdotal notes and counseling employees as needed.
  • Establish priorities for patient care, prepare and revise patient care schedules, and observe for disruptions in the even flow of patients through the unit.
  • Evaluate procedures periodically and revise them as necessary.
  • Investigate and prepare reports on accidents and other incidents involving patients, employees, and visitors.

Requirements:

  • A license to practice as a Registered Nurse issued by the California Board of Registered Nursing.
  • Two years of experience as a registered nurse leading staff in the provision of nursing care or services.
  • Current certification in accordance with the American Heart Association's Basic Life Support (BLS) for Healthcare Providers (CPR & AED) Program.
